Transaction 6da166dc22a9b2a0ecf997aaf3090b573cb44d0efa9495576ceaba6296ad766f
1 Input
1 Output
-
6da166dc22a9b2a0ecf997aaf3090b573cb44d0efa9495576ceaba6296ad766f:0
- value
- 271658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86f18b8ba4b747569a5ecf0dde852321e0aa5fa5 OP_EQUAL
- address
- 3DzXq6ZnUaTe1b1qFyedwk29SfxPJ5Emfh